WestJet flight dispatchers — represented by the Canadian Airline Dispatchers Association (CALDA) — voted 90 per cent in favour of a three-year agreement on May 18.
“This agreement is beneficial for the long-term sustainability of WestJet, WestJet Dispatchers and our WestJetters,” said Jeff Martin, WestJet COO.
The vote does not include WestJet Encore.
“This is a positive step in the right direction and a testament to WestJetters working together,” said Justin Jones, WestJet CALDA chair.
The agreement starts on May 18, 2019, and expires on May 18, 2022.
